You will find in her Studio not only acrylic seascapes and sea life paintings, but also watercolours of Port Isaac buildings, detailed studies of sea shells/seaweeds, linocut prints and beachcombed driftwood/shell handmade wreaths and wall hangings. Stacey loves finding new ways to express her creativity and her love of Cornwall.
Port Isaac is bustling with creative people including her neighbour Lyndsey who has her art studio next door. Set into the old Pentus wall the studio not only has stunning views but also the calming sounds of the sea and the gulls.

The Studio is situated in an old fish cellar up a slope and therefore the walk up to the cellar is on an old uneven path which can be slippery when wet and not accessible by wheel chairs
Directions
Park at the top of the village and walk down Fore Street past The Mote onto the Platt walk down towards the beach and follow the signs on the right to the sea wall. The Pilchard Press Studio is the last fish cellar at the end.
